I'd say you make some interesting points there, abusive.  Couple things to add.

- I think beyond loyalty, the deal Suge turned down would not have made sense. If the Tucker deal is in fact, the one in question. It was basically akin to Suge giving up a portion of his label to the people who were boycotting it so they could help him run a clean and responsible product. It would have killed Death Row completely. On the same token, Jimmy was also loyal in the sense that Interscope stayed attached to Death Row when Time Warner got cold feet and even bought their portion of the company when they got scared away.

I think for both men, Suge and Jimmy, they were the best deal for each other at the time.

- I would agree that Game's deal has always seemed a little fucked.  I can't imagine he is making much money off music with all the deals he's had to get out of but I doubt they are getting a part of his advertising dollars. One of 50's initial gripes with that man was he went and did another deal outside of G-Unit for some commercial time. If 50 was getting a cut, I'm sure it would not have been as big an issue.
